About this tender

Cardinia Shire Council is seeking tenders for Pakenham Revitalisation Stage 5 – John St Extension in Pakenham, Victoria. The project involves civil construction services including road construction, streetscape works, earthworks, kerb and channel installation, footpaths, drainage, and associated civil infrastructure. This is a road and streetscape construction and maintenance project categorised under civil and earthworks services.

How to respond to this tender

A strong tender response is clear, compliant, and backed by evidence. These steps apply to most Australian and New Zealand public tenders.

Read the requirements in full

Open the official listing and download the full tender pack. Note the response schedules, evaluation criteria, mandatory conditions, and the exact closing time and lodgement method.

Confirm you are eligible and it is worth bidding

Check licences, insurances, certifications, and any conformance requirements before you commit. A quick bid or no-bid decision saves days of wasted effort on a tender you cannot win.

Answer every criterion with evidence

Respond to each evaluation criterion directly and back your claims with concrete examples, referees, and past performance. Address the buyer’s stated need, not a generic capability statement.

Lodge early through the official portal

Submit through the source portal well before the deadline. Late or incorrectly lodged bids are almost always rejected, so leave time for uploads, portal errors, and last-minute questions.
